Botanical Plant Name:
Petunia ‘Dreams Patriot Mix’ (Dreams Series)
Looking to add a little patriotic flair to the garden? Welcome Dreams Patriot Mix into your containers and borders. Featuring large, funnel-shaped blooms in red, white and purple-blue, these pretty, ever-blooming bedding annuals require little maintenance and are perfect for gardens in need of long-lasting color. They grow best in fertile soil with good drainage and full to partial sun. |
